The Taxpayer Protection Pledge from Americans for Tax Reform is a commitment from your Pennsylvania Senator or House member to vote against any and all tax increases in Pennsylvania.  Each election cycle, your lawmaker is asked to renew the pledge for the next term. 

 

Taxpayer Protection Pledge

 

I, ____________, pledge to the taxpayers of the

_____ District of the Commonwealth of Pennsylvania

 and to all the people of this state, that I will oppose

and vote against any and all efforts to increase taxes.
